Our Hours:

Tuesday: 10 am - 2 pm

Friday: 10 am - 2 pm

 

Who is eligible to receive food from this pantry? Persons who reside in Trumann and the 72472 zip code area, who without help would be short of food for the month. You may receive one box once per calendar month as long as there is a need.
To receive assistance you must provide a current picture ID and a current rent receipt or a current utility bill.

What is a food pantry ?

Many communities have a local "food pantry", sometimes mistakenly called a "food bank". Most of these community food pantries are sponsored by local area churches and/or community coalitions. 

A community food pantry’s mission is to directly serve local  residents who suffer from hunger and food insecurity within a specified area.

Independent community food pantries are self-governing and usually distribute food to their clients on a once-a-month basis.

A food bank is the storehouse for millions of pounds of food and other products that go out to the community. A food pantry functions as the arms that reach out to that community directly.
